使用性能分析工具定位热点代码,结合编译器优化与代码重构提升C++程序效率,重点优化高频调用函数和内存访问模式。

在C++开发中,性能优化是提升程序效率的关键环节。有效的性能分析能帮助开发者定位瓶颈,针对性地进行优化。以下是一些常用的C++代码性能分析方法和优化策略。
性能分析工具是定位耗时代码段的核心手段。常见的工具有:
性能分析的重点是找出占用最多CPU时间的函数或代码块。这些“热点”通常是优化的首要目标。
合理使用编译器优化可以显著提升性能。
启科网络商城系统由启科网络技术开发团队完全自主开发,使用国内最流行高效的PHP程序语言,并用小巧的MySql作为数据库服务器,并且使用Smarty引擎来分离网站程序与前端设计代码,让建立的网站可以自由制作个性化的页面。 系统使用标签作为数据调用格式,网站前台开发人员只要简单学习系统标签功能和使用方法,将标签设置在制作的HTML模板中进行对网站数据、内容、信息等的调用,即可建设出美观、个性的网站。
0
立即学习“C++免费学习笔记(深入)”;
在理解性能瓶颈后,可通过重构代码提升效率。
基本上就这些。性能优化不是一蹴而就的过程,需要结合工具分析和代码实践反复迭代。关键是先测量,再优化,避免过早优化(premature optimization)带来的复杂性和维护成本。
以上就是C++如何进行代码性能分析和优化_C++ 代码性能分析方法的详细内容,更多请关注php中文网其它相关文章!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号